James Polk was born in Waxahachie, Texas, on June 12, 1949. He transitioned in Garland, Texas, on September 16, 2019, at age 70.
James graduated from Waxahachie High School. He went on to attend college at Brantley Draughon Business School. James retired from Pitney Bowes Management Services after many years of service.
James accepted Christ as his personal Lord and Savior. He was a member of Abundant Life Church where he was known as "The Roving Greeter". He delighted working Vacation Bible School each year at Abundant Life.
A hard-working and gentle soul with an incredible smile and love for family time, James will be greatly missed by all who knew and loved him.
He was preceded in death by his grandparents who also raised him, John Wesley and Gertie Polk; parents, Johnny Lee "Boots" Polk and Addie Bell Perry Franklin; aunts: Ruby Tunson, Ruthie Irving, and Margurite Jones; sister, Carolyn Ealim; and cousins: Walter "Peaches" Tunson, Carlos "Spank" Irving, and Jimmie Jones. Those left to cherish precious memories include his wife of 48 years, Linda Polk; daughter, Collette LaShea Polk; son, Brian Wesley Polk; grandchildren, Aaron Branch and Avery Valentine; great-grandchildren, Ayden Valentine and Aaron Noah Branch; sisters, Brenda Harris (David) and Olivia Piper; brother, Jeoffrey Williams (Angela); niece, Danielle Harris; nephew, David Harris, Jr.; special cousin, Carolyn Ruth Pittman (Ronnie); and a host of cousins and friends.
